As wireless power technologies mature, integrating a Wireless Charging Module into oral care or cosmetic devices is becoming a strategic upgrade for premium product lines. However, this innovation directly impacts Kit Packaging design, influencing everything from internal structure and material selection to user unboxing experience and logistics efficiency. For B2B manufacturers and OEM partners, packaging must evolve alongside charging technology.
A Wireless Charging Module introduces additional components such as coils, receivers, and alignment structures. Kit Packaging must be redesigned to secure these elements during transit, preventing coil deformation, magnetic interference, or connector stress.
Wireless charging often allows the removal of exposed charging ports, but it may require additional internal space. Kit Packaging designers must balance compact outer dimensions with sufficient internal clearance to accommodate charging pads, docks, or multi-device layouts.
Certain packaging materials can interfere with wireless charging efficiency. When a Wireless Charging Module is included, Kit Packaging must avoid excessive metal layers or shielding materials that could reduce charging performance during in-box demonstrations or testing.
Wireless charging is still a learning curve for some users. Kit Packaging plays an educational role by clearly presenting the charging orientation, usage steps, and compatibility notes through inserts, icons, or molded trays—reducing post-purchase confusion.
A Wireless Charging Module may generate heat during operation or testing. Kit Packaging must account for ventilation, thermal tolerance, and compliance labeling, especially for products shipped internationally under varying regulatory frameworks.
From a branding perspective, including a Wireless Charging Module elevates product value. Well-designed Kit Packaging reinforces this premium positioning through structured presentation, minimalistic layouts, and high-quality finishes that align with advanced technology messaging.
Including a Wireless Charging Module is not just a product-level decision—it reshapes the entire Kit Packaging strategy. For B2B manufacturers, thoughtful packaging design ensures protection, usability, compliance, and brand differentiation, ultimately supporting scalable production and stronger market competitiveness.
